Why Carols by Candlelight didn’t top week’s ratings

Ratings: From 1.28m viewers to 689,000? Here's why.

You would think with an audience of 1.28m viewers that Carols by Candlelight would have topped the week’s ratings.

Instead its final figure is around half that size: 689,000 viewers.

Why? Because it was replayed on Christmas Day and was not recoded as a separate title, so the final figure is the average of both broadcasts. A sleepy summer lesson learned as the year kicks off….

Still, Nine can take solace in the fact it comfortably won the week, with The Ashes Fourth Test S3 officially the week’s top ranking title at 939,000 viewers.

TEN won the 16-39 demo (and beat Seven for all 3) while Nine scored 18-49 and 25-54.

The Big Bash League continues to deliver for TEN, including ONE topping the multichannels.
